WEEK 2 – TYPES OF VALUES THAT PROMOTES PEACE

MEANING OF VALUES

Values are good behaviours and principles that guide how we act and live with other people. Values that promote peace are good behaviours that help people live together without fighting or quarrelling.

 

TYPES OF VALUES THAT PROMOTE PEACE

1. Love is caring for others and showing kindness.

2. Tolerance is accepting people’s differences and opinions.

3. Respect is treating others politely and fairly.

4. Honesty is telling the truth and being trustworthy.

5. Cooperation is working together peacefully.

6. Patience is being calm and not quick to anger.

7. Fairness is treating everyone equally.

8. Forgiveness is letting go of anger and avoiding revenge.

 

IMPORTANCE OF VALUES THAT PROMOTE PEACE

1. Reduce conflicts and quarrels.

2. Encourage unity and friendship.

3. Promote peaceful living at home, school, and community.
